Improvements to DCHAIN-SP and its data libraries

Ratliff, H.  ; 今野 力  ; 松田 規宏  ; 佐藤 達彦   

Ratliff, H.; Konno, Chikara; Matsuda, Norihiro; Sato, Tatsuhiko

DCHAIN-SP, the radionuclide build-up and decay code distributed alongside and used with the PHITS particle transport code, currently does not propagate statistical uncertainties from values calculated in PHITS through its own calculations, allowing for misinterpretation of results as being of high statistical clarity regardless of whether that is the case. This work resolves this concern by implementing statistical uncertainty propagation functionality. Additionally, DCHAIN-SP relies on fairly dated data libraries-decay data from 1980s and 1990s evaluations and neutron reaction cross sections from a 2005 evaluation-which have now been modernized to evaluations from the past five years. The presentation will highlight some of the improvements these modern libraries have over the older ones. DCHAIN-SP has not had major development in years, particularly concerning its data libraries, and this presentation will alert past and potential future users that this code is being updated.
